パッケージ jakarta.servlet.jsp.el
クラス NotFoundELResolver
- java.lang.ObjectSE
-
- jakarta.el.ELResolver
-
- jakarta.servlet.jsp.el.NotFoundELResolver
public class NotFoundELResolver extends ELResolver
他のすべてのリゾルバーが失敗した場合の変数の解決を定義します。- 導入:
- JSP 3.1
フィールドサマリー
クラス jakarta.el.ELResolver から継承されたフィールド
RESOLVABLE_AT_DESIGN_TIME, TYPE
コンストラクターのサマリー
コンストラクター コンストラクター 説明 NotFoundELResolver()
メソッドのサマリー
すべてのメソッド インスタンスメソッド 具象メソッド 修飾子と型 メソッド 説明 ClassSE<StringSE>
getCommonPropertyType(ELContext context, ObjectSE base)
通常の使用ではScopedAttributeELResolver
がELResolver.getCommonPropertyType(ELContext, Object)
への呼び出しを処理するため、常にnull
を返します。ClassSE<ObjectSE>
getType(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.getType(ELContext, Object, Object)
への呼び出しを処理するため、常にnull
を返します。ObjectSE
getValue(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.getValue(ELContext, Object, Object)
への呼び出しを処理するため、常にnull
を返します。boolean
isReadOnly(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.isReadOnly(ELContext, Object, Object)
への呼び出しを処理するため、常にfalse
を返します。void
setValue(ELContext context, ObjectSE base, ObjectSE property, ObjectSE val)
通常の使用ではScopedAttributeELResolver
がELResolver.setValue(ELContext, Object, Object, Object)
への呼び出しを処理するため、常に NO-OP です。クラス jakarta.el.ELResolver から継承されたメソッド
convertToType, getFeatureDescriptors, invoke
メソッドの詳細
getValue
public ObjectSE getValue(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.getValue(ELContext, Object, Object)
への呼び出しを処理するため、常にnull
を返します。ELContext
オブジェクトのpropertyResolved
プロパティは、戻る前にこのリゾルバーによって常にtrue
に設定されます。- 次で指定:
- クラス
ELResolver
のgetValue
- パラメーター:
context
- この評価のコンテキスト。base
- 無視property
- 無視- 戻り値:
- 常に
null
- 例外:
NullPointerExceptionSE
- コンテキストがnull
の場合PropertyNotFoundException
- 指定されたコンテキストに、キーjakarta.servlet.jsp.el.NotFoundELResolver.class
に関連付けられた値として値Boolean.TRUE
を持つブールオブジェクトが含まれている場合。これは、errorOnELNotFound
ページ / タグディレクティブの実装をサポートするためのものです。ELException
- プロパティまたは変数の解決の実行中に例外がスローされた場合。スローされた例外は、可能であれば、この例外の原因プロパティとして含める必要があります。
getType
public ClassSE<ObjectSE> getType(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.getType(ELContext, Object, Object)
への呼び出しを処理するため、常にnull
を返します。- 次で指定:
- クラス
ELResolver
のgetType
- パラメーター:
context
- この評価のコンテキスト。base
- 無視property
- 無視- 戻り値:
- 常に
null
- 例外:
NullPointerExceptionSE
- コンテキストがnull
の場合ELException
- プロパティまたは変数の解決の実行中に例外がスローされた場合。スローされた例外は、可能であれば、この例外の原因プロパティとして含める必要があります。
setValue
public void setValue(ELContext context, ObjectSE base, ObjectSE property, ObjectSE val)
通常の使用ではScopedAttributeELResolver
がELResolver.setValue(ELContext, Object, Object, Object)
への呼び出しを処理するため、常に NO-OP です。- 次で指定:
- クラス
ELResolver
のsetValue
- パラメーター:
context
- この評価のコンテキスト。base
- 無視property
- 無視val
- 無視- 例外:
NullPointerExceptionSE
- コンテキストがnull
の場合。ELException
- プロパティまたは変数の解決の実行中に例外がスローされた場合。スローされた例外は、可能であれば、この例外の原因プロパティとして含める必要があります。
isReadOnly
public boolean isReadOnly(ELContext context, ObjectSE base, ObjectSE property)
通常の使用ではScopedAttributeELResolver
がELResolver.isReadOnly(ELContext, Object, Object)
への呼び出しを処理するため、常にfalse
を返します。- 次で指定:
- クラス
ELResolver
のisReadOnly
- パラメーター:
context
- この評価のコンテキスト。base
- 無視property
- 無視- 戻り値:
- 常に
false
- 例外:
NullPointerExceptionSE
- コンテキストがnull
の場合。ELException
- プロパティまたは変数の解決の実行中に例外がスローされた場合。スローされた例外は、可能であれば、この例外の原因プロパティとして含める必要があります。
getCommonPropertyType
public ClassSE<StringSE> getCommonPropertyType(ELContext context, ObjectSE base)
通常の使用ではScopedAttributeELResolver
がELResolver.getCommonPropertyType(ELContext, Object)
への呼び出しを処理するため、常にnull
を返します。- 次で指定:
- クラス
ELResolver
のgetCommonPropertyType
- パラメーター:
context
- 無視base
- 無視- 戻り値:
- 常に
null